About my class

My students are the sweetest group of 6th graders, and they come from all around NYC. Not yet too-cool-for-school adolescents, they are energetic and eager learners. I remember reading an article once about a tribe of Indians whose songs were all about water. When asked by the journalist why, the chieftain replied, "Because we have so little." The students I teach would write their songs about money and big houses.
